Introduction to Nikon Coolpix P950 Video Features
The Nikon Coolpix P950 offers 4K UHD video recording, allowing users to capture detailed footage even during extended shooting sessions. Its 83x optical zoom provides flexibility to shoot distant subjects without sacrificing image quality.
Preparing for Extended Shots
Before starting your video session, ensure your camera is fully charged and has ample storage space. Use a high-capacity SD card to avoid interruptions during long recordings. Adjust your settings for optimal performance during extended shoots.
Setting Video Resolution and Frame Rate
Navigate to the menu and select 4K UHD (3840×2160) resolution at 30fps for smooth footage. For longer recordings, consider lowering the frame rate to 24fps to reduce file size while maintaining good quality.
Using Power Saving and Battery Management
Enable power-saving modes to extend battery life. Carry extra batteries or a portable charger if planning to shoot for several hours. Turn off Wi-Fi and other non-essential features to conserve energy.
Techniques for Extended Shots
Stability is crucial for long recordings. Use a tripod or gimbal to keep your camera steady. Monitor your shot periodically to ensure the camera remains focused and properly exposed.
Adjusting Focus and Exposure
Set your autofocus to continuous mode to maintain focus during movement. Use manual exposure settings if lighting conditions change significantly to prevent flickering or overexposure.
Managing Heat and Overheating
Extended recording can cause the camera to heat up. Take breaks between sessions and ensure proper ventilation. Keep the camera out of direct sunlight to prevent overheating.
Post-Recording Tips
After recording, review your footage for stability and clarity. Transfer files promptly to avoid data loss. Use editing software to trim or enhance your videos as needed.
